What is a Modern Learning Environment? (MLE)

•• They tend to have increased flexibility, openness and a greater access

to resources

• Teacher - student ratios are reduced

• Far greater opportunities for collaboration student(s) to student(s), teacher(s) to student(s)

Physical environments that support the needs of a modern learner

Page 9: A Modern Learning Environment at Ladbrooks School Sharing and Thinking Collaboratively.

Collaborative teaching?

• Several teachers with many children

• Often multi-level and various age groups

• Can be in one space, MLE or in traditional class set up

• All teachers are responsible for all learners **

• Individual needs are catered for effectively

• Teacher expertise exponentially increased

Page 11: A Modern Learning Environment at Ladbrooks School Sharing and Thinking Collaboratively.

Collaborative teaching?

• Supports strength-based teaching

• When there is one teacher, the learning is often serialWhen there is a team, it is parallel and learning is faster

• Additional possibilities for Gifted and Talented and remedial attention

• Increased connectivity between students and staff

• Teachers have told us they wouldn’t want to teach any other way
